Maintenance

A robot cleaner is a great method of keeping your home tidy, especially if you have children or pets. It will require some attention to keep it in top condition. Making sure you are keeping up with routine cleaning tasks, such as emptying the trash bin and washing or replacing the filter, and wiping down cameras and sensors can prolong the life of your robot.

Vacuums need more frequent maintenance than mopping robots, but you can prolong the life of your vacuum by following instructions from the manufacturer for emptying and cleaning the dustbin, brush roll and filter. Wipe down the robot's charging contacts and sensor using a damp rag to avoid them becoming blocked.
